Borrowed from Old Occitan coratge or Old French corage, from Latin cor (“heart”).
coragem f (plural coragens)
- courage; boldness; guts (the quality of not being scared easily)
- courage; audacity; insolence (the quality of being insolent)
- Synonyms: audácia, insolência, desfaçatez
- Antonym: gentileza
